File Integrity Monitoring (FIM) is a critical security control for PCI DSS compliance, specifically addressing the protection of logs and the detection of unauthorized changes to system files. Key PCI DSS Requirements for FIM Achieving PCI DSS 10
: Mandates using FIM or change-detection software on logs to ensure existing data cannot be modified without generating an alert. Importantly, new data being appended to logs should not trigger these alerts. Achieving PCI DSS 10
: Requires FIM to alert personnel of unauthorized modifications to critical system files , configuration files, or content files. Achieving PCI DSS 10
: Under Requirement 11.5, the software must be configured to perform critical file comparisons at least once a week . Implementation Best Practices
